Tan*_*anu 11 python pyro celery
我想了解Celery,并想知道Celery和Pyro是否正在努力实现同样的目标?
有人可以告诉我,如果有什么东西可以做什么Pyro不能,反之亦然?
Osc*_*áez 15
正如我在官方网站上看到的那样,Celery和Pyro打算做不同的工作,但这种困惑很自然.
这两个软件包的目标是帮助您进行分布式计算,但采用不同的方法:Celery打算成为分布式任务调度程序,这意味着,如果您有一堆任务(非常不相关),您可以通过计算机网格分发它们或通过网络.
虽然,Pyro旨在通过网络在对象之间建立通信网关,但是,如果你有一个相当大的任务,那就意味着你不能分成几个不相关的任务,而是用一堆对象,这些对象是独立的,但通常需要有关其他信息,然后Pyro启用它们之间的通信,因此您可以执行在计算机网格或网络上分发对象的任务.
你使用Django标签发布这个,所以你可以说,对Web应用程序执行的请求可以看作是不相关任务的一堆(并发增加的一个大问题),所以Celery可能会这样做是你在找什么.
| 归档时间: |
|
| 查看次数: |
3934 次 |
| 最近记录: |